MySQL 是一種基于關系模型的數據庫管理系統,用戶信息是一個數據庫中至關重要的部分。在 MySQL 中,通常將用戶信息存儲在用戶表中。當需要將用戶表導出或導入到其他 MySQL 數據庫時,需要一些技巧和方法。
要導入一個用戶表,我們需要創建一個具有適當權限的用戶,以便在新增表時能夠創建表、插入數據和更改表中的數據。使用以下 SQL 語句以創建一個新的 MySQL 用戶。
CREATE USER 'new_user'@'localhost' IDENTIFIED BY 'password'; GRANT ALL ON *.* TO 'new_user'@'localhost';
在以上 SQL 語句中,'new_user' 是要創建的新用戶的用戶名,'password' 是要為該用戶設置的密碼。要啟用該用戶對所有數據庫和所有表的訪問權限,可以使用 'ALL' 關鍵字作為 GRANT 命令的參數。
在創建新用戶并為其分配了所需的權限之后,我們可以開始導入用戶表。最簡單的方法是將表導出為 SQL 腳本,隨后使用導入命令來成功地導入表。使用以下命令可以將現有用戶表導出為 SQL 文件:
mysqldump -u [用戶名] -p [數據庫名] [表名] >[文件名].sql
此命令將全用戶表導出為文件 '[文件名].sql'。在導出完成后,我們可以使用以下命令將該 SQL 文件導入到目標服務器中的 MySQL 數據庫中:
mysql -u [用戶名] -p [數據庫名]< [文件名].sql
使用以上命令可以輕松地導入位于 SQL 文件中的表。
本文介紹了將 MySQL 用戶表導入到其他 MySQL 數據庫的過程。創建一個新用戶并分配它需要的權限是導入成功的關鍵。使用 mysqldump 命令將用戶表導出為 SQL 文件,隨后將它導入 MySQL 數據庫為最簡單的方法。
上一篇css 怎么變成半透明
下一篇css 怎么去掉雙引號